Liston vs. Joshi: Weirder and Weirder

We wrote recently about the swiftly nastifying Republican primary in El Paso County’s House District 16, where incumbent Rep. Janak “Dr. Nick” Joshi is battling to hold off a strong challenge from former Rep. Larry Liston. After breaking with longstanding General Assembly protocol by using Liston’s appearance in a humorous sketch-comedy bit known as the “Hummers” against him in a campaign ad, Team Joshi launched a website, LarryLies.com, with a radio buy ripping Liston on a variety of conservative wedge issues.

Well folks, yesterday this video was posted to LarryLies.com, and it’s sure to jack up the acrimony in this race as ballots start to come back:

We don’t know anything about the incident as told by a woman named Peg Hankins in the video above, but she describes asking then-Rep. Liston a question at an event of some kind and getting manhandled in response–to the extent that she claims to have had bruises on her arms from Liston grabbing her. There’s no mention of any police report or further action taken by the woman against Liston, which means we of course have no way of corroborating any of these accusations.

It’s tough to say how this might affect the HD-16 primary, since we doubt LarryLies.com is in sufficient circulation among primary voters in this district to make a difference one way or the other. We’ll have to see if Joshi’s campaign is able to generate media coverage of this woman’s story–and whether that coverage gives this story credibility or takes it away.

Either way, yeesh. It’s sure getting ugly down there.
